Add Blossom bandwidth limiting and tune rate limiters (v0.49.0)
Some checks failed
Go / build-and-release (push) Has been cancelled

- Add token-bucket bandwidth rate limiting for Blossom uploads
  - ORLY_BLOSSOM_RATE_LIMIT enables limiting (default: false)
  - ORLY_BLOSSOM_DAILY_LIMIT_MB sets daily limit (default: 10MB)
  - ORLY_BLOSSOM_BURST_LIMIT_MB sets burst cap (default: 50MB)
  - Followed users, admins, owners are exempt (unlimited)
- Change emergency mode throttling from exponential to linear scaling
  - Old: 16x multiplier at emergency threshold entry
  - New: 1x at threshold, +1x per 20% excess pressure
- Reduce follows ACL throttle increment from 200ms to 25ms per event
- Update dependencies

Files modified:
- app/blossom.go: Pass rate limit config to blossom server
- app/config/config.go: Add Blossom rate limit config options
- pkg/blossom/ratelimit.go: New bandwidth limiter implementation
- pkg/blossom/server.go: Add rate limiter integration
- pkg/blossom/handlers.go: Check rate limits on upload/mirror/media
- pkg/ratelimit/limiter.go: Linear emergency throttling
- pkg/acl/follows.go: Reduce default throttle increment
